Oracle EXP工具的停留路径探索(oracle exp停留)

Oracle EXP工具的停留:路径探索

介绍

Oracle EXP是Oracle数据库中的一个工具,它可以用来将一个数据库对象导出到一个可传输的文件中。虽然这个工具已经被Oracle官方不推荐使用,但在一些老版本的Oracle数据库中,它仍然是一个非常常用的工具。在使用这个工具的过程中,有时我们需要对导出路径进行探索,以便更好地管理我们的文件。

路径探索

在使用Oracle EXP工具导出文件时,我们需要指定一个导出路径。而这个路径可以是相对路径或者绝对路径。如果指定的是相对路径,那么Oracle EXP会将当前工作目录附加在指定路径的前面,以构造完整的路径。例如,我们在Windows系统下执行以下命令:

exp scott/tiger@orcl tables=EMP file=data.dmp

其中的file参数指定了导出文件的名称,但并没有指定导出路径。这种情况下,Oracle EXP会将当前工作目录附加在文件名前面,以得到完整路径。如果当前工作目录是D:\data,那么导出文件的路径将是D:\data\data.dmp。

如果要使用绝对路径,可以直接在导出路径前面加上具体的路径,例如:

exp scott/tiger@orcl tables=EMP file=D:\data\data.dmp

除了指定导出路径以外,还可以指定导出的文件格式。Oracle EXP支持两种不同的导出格式:二进制格式(.dmp文件)和可移植格式(.pdp文件)。前者适用于同一操作系统下的Oracle数据库之间的导出和导入,后者适用于不同操作系统之间的导出和导入,例如 Windows 和 Unix/Linux 之间的导出和导入。

总结

在使用Oracle EXP工具进行导出的时候,我们需要指定导出路径和导出格式。路径可以是相对路径或者绝对路径。如果指定的是相对路径,Oracle EXP会将当前工作目录附加在路径前面,以构造完整路径。导出格式可以是二进制格式(.dmp文件)或者可移植格式(.pdp文件)。通过有效的路径探索,我们能够更好地管理我们的导出文件,提高工作效率。以下是一个简单的示例代码:

exp scott/tiger@orcl tables=EMP file=data.dmp

参考链接

Oracle EXP工具的文档:https://docs.oracle.com/cd/B19306_01/server.102/b14357/exp_imp.htm

路径探索的相关文献:https://www.kdnuggets.com/2020/02/python-path-exploration.html

示例代码来源:https://gist.github.com/iamstu/86afedfcd853cba543c925de3b7303e3


数据运维技术 » Oracle EXP工具的停留路径探索(oracle exp停留)